Glenn Russell

Department Chair/Associate Professor of Religion and Biblical Languages at Andrews University

Dr. Glenn Russell was born to missionary parents in Egypt and grew up in Lebanon. He has served as a pastor and as an academy Bible teacher. Currently he is a professor of world religions and missions and chair of the Department of Religion and Biblical Languages at Andrews University. Passionate about global missions, Russell directs several mission trips each year as well as speaking or teaching in over 20 countries. He is host of the weekly radio & media program Scriptural Pursuit. He is married to Sharon Russell, a retired reading specialist, and they have two adult children.
